Translation with Multi-Book Ledger

A ledger company inherits the translation setup of the General Ledger company it is associated with. Multi-Book Ledger provides both report currency translation (intracompany) and currency translation (intercompany). Multi-Book Ledger uses the same translation codes and translation rates as the General Ledger company. Multi-Book Ledger provides its own translation programs, which translate only ledger company data. The Multi-Book Ledger translation programs work in exactly the same manner as the General Ledger translation programs.

When you produce Multi-Book Ledger financial statements in report currency, the Multi-Book Ledger report pulls the translated amounts from the ledger company and combines them with the translated amounts from the General Ledger company.
